Probe zero offset
High differences in temperature 
If the differences in temperature between the storage 
and inspection site are high, it is necessary that you wait 
approx. 2 minutes before you use the instrument after 
connecting the probe.
Temperatures below –10 °C
The probe zero offset does not always function correctly 
at temperatures below –10 °C. You should therefore 
carry out a 2-point calibration and repeat it in the case 
of major temperature jumps.
Couplant residues
In order to ensure a correct probe zero offset, make sure 
that you always remove the couplant residues before 
carrying out a new measurement after decoupling the 
probe.
Measuring accuracy 
Keep in mind that the measuring accuracy is not identi-
cal with the display accuracy.
The measuring accuracy depends on the following fac-
tors:
● Temperature
● Probe delay line
● Constancy of sound velocity
● Uniformity of surface quality
